LB1202, Please give Pete a call in Service (870-481-5135, M-F, 8-4:30pm CST). He might like to have your serial number?psj,This is caused from leaving the rear seat in place all the time. The aluminum seat pole with time wallows out the fiberglass just a bit and makes it loose. It creates a space between the fiberglass deck and the seat pole. We have nothing that will by an easy or quick fix. What we have done here is wrap tape around the alum. seat pole under the deck from inside the battery compartment. Then from the top side pour resin or an epoxy based filler into the void to tighten up and fill that void. The tape on the bottom side just acts as a dam to keep the resin or epoxy from running down the seat pole and not building up. So the tape is wrapped around the poll to build up thickness.BCB Admin
